ON Semiconductor MM3Z20VT1G Zener Diode
The ON Semiconductor MM3Z20VT1G is a high-quality Zener diode, designed for providing excellent voltage regulation with a nominal Zener voltage of 20V. This surface-mount device is packaged in a convenient SOD-323 package, making it suitable for high-density PCB applications. The MM3Z20VT1G is typically used in voltage stabilization and clipping circuits, offering a sharp Zener knee characteristic and low leakage current.
Key Features:
- Zener Voltage (VZ): 20V, providing precise voltage regulation for a wide range of applications.
- Power Dissipation: The device is capable of dissipating up to 300mW, ensuring reliable operation under typical ambient temperatures.
- Package: SOD-323, a small and flat package that is ideal for automated assembly processes and space-constrained applications.
- Standard Zener Breakdown Voltage Range: The MM3Z20VT1G offers a breakdown voltage range of 18.8V to 21.2V, providing flexibility and performance stability across various conditions.
- Low Leakage Current: This characteristic is crucial for maintaining energy efficiency and minimizing power loss in circuitry.
- High Surge Capability: The device can handle surge currents, making it robust against transient voltage spikes and enhancing circuit protection.
- Lead-Free, Halogen-Free and RoHS compliant: The MM3Z20VT1G meets environmental standards, reducing the environmental impact and complying with global regulations for electronic components.
